Hartford is one of Cheshire's most popular villages, combining rural appeal with first class accessibility and a superb range of amenities. The village boasts a number of shops, including newsagents, pharmacy, florist, butchers and two general convenience stores. In addition, there are two very popular cafes/wine bars that also serve food throughout the day.

Hartford is renowned for its superb educational facilities catering for all age groups, including the highly reputable and very popular Grange School (Junior and Secondary level), Hartford Church of England High School, St Wilfred's Primary School, St Nicholas's Roman Catholic High School and a day nursery.

With regards to leisure facilities, there are several golf clubs nearby, a tennis/bowls club and many beautiful walks along the river Weaver, accessed from well planned public footpaths. Hartford is well positioned to take advantage of outdoor activities in central Cheshire, including dog walking, horse riding and rambling, with the Whitegate Way, Marbury Country Park, Delamere Forest and the Sandstone Trail all with easy travel distance.

Within walking distance are two railway stations - Greenbank (Manchester to Chester line) and Hartford (Liverpool - Crewe - London). Road access to the M6, M53 and M56 is afforded by the A556 and the A49, making commuting to Chester, Warrington, Liverpool and Manchester and MediaCityUK easily accessible. For those who require European or international travel, Liverpool and Manchester International Airports can be accessed within 45 minutes drive.
